What the Stockton market looks like

Stockton is largely in Pacific Gas and Electric territory, which matters for affiliation policies and price layout. California's shift to Web Payment, commonly called NEM 3.0, changed the export value of daytime solar power. The credit report you obtain for sending out power to the grid is lower than retail rates and varies by time of day and period. Under these guidelines, the most effective solar layouts aim to counter late‑afternoon and evening usage, when prices are higher and export credit ratings are stronger. That commonly means orienting some panels to the southwest rather than due south, and seriously thinking about battery storage to time‑shift production.

Sunlight is not the restricting factor. Common solar resource in the Central Valley averages approximately 5 to 6 top sunlight hours per day for many years. On a practical degree, a well‑placed 7 kW property system in Stockton typically creates 9,500 to 11,000 kWh in the initial year, presuming very little shading and standard tools. If your home rests under fully grown camphor trees or you have a two‑story following door casting a shadow by midafternoon, anticipate less. Excellent solar business quantify shielding with website surveys and software application instead of presuming from satellite images alone.

Local roofing systems trend towards structure roof shingles and concrete floor tile, with pockets of older Spanish clay floor tile and some level foam or TPO on additions and ADUs. Each roofing type has its very own placing hardware and mount strategy. Floor tile roofing systems, common in newer neighborhoods, call for more labor for ceramic tile cutting Stockton solar installers or ceramic tile replacement installs. That affects price and the capability you must insist on when you limit solar installment Stockton options.

Equipment selections that hold up in the Central Valley

Summer warmth in Stockton routinely pushes panel temperatures well over the basic examination conditions made use of to price output. Every panel has a temperature coefficient that informs you just how much power it sheds as it gets hot. Picking components with a better coefficient assists in July and August. The difference might look small on paper, state adverse 0.35 percent per level Celsius versus adverse 0.40, but under a blistering mid-day that adds up over decades.

Inverters matter more than most shiny brochures admit. Microinverters, like those from Enphase, isolate panel performance and take care of complex roof covering aircrafts with partial shielding well. String inverters with DC optimizers, commonly from SolarEdge, can cost much less per watt and do at a high degree if made carefully. Either technique works in Stockton. What issues is that the installer matches the architecture to your roof covering format and shade profile, and that replacement parts will come in 5 to fifteen years.

Mounting and waterproofing can make or damage a roofing system. On make-up shingle, flashed infiltrations with stainless hardware and butyl gaskets are conventional. Tile needs raised standoffs and flashing that tucks appropriately under ceramic tiles. Ask how many roofing system infiltrations your layout requires. There is no magic number, but an installer who describes their racking layout and shows details from a comparable regional home is generally the one who will treat your roof carefully.

If you are thinking about storage space, San Joaquin Region house owners normally look at 10 to 20 kWh of battery capability for vital loads, a fridge and freezer, Wi‑Fi, some lights, and a small ductless mini‑split. Batteries do 2 tasks here. They maintain the lights on during a blackout and they arbitrage time‑of‑use rates by charging at lunchtime and discharging in the evening. PG&E interruption danger in Stockton is less than in foothill fire areas, but tornado failures, local tools failures, and planned upkeep can still leave a home dark several times a year. Choose whether you want whole‑home back-up or a safeguarded lots panel. Whole‑home usually needs more batteries and updated solution equipment.

Price reality, funding, and incentives

Residential turnkey rates in California extends a large range. Around Stockton, a simple composition tile roof covering with a single range plane could land between 2.25 and 3.50 bucks per watt prior to incentives for trusted installers utilizing Tier 1 components and mainstream inverters. Floor tile roof coverings, made complex rooflines, and solution upgrades can press that to 3.75 to 4.25 bucks per watt. Tiny tasks, like a 3 kW add‑on, frequently set you back even more per watt since taken care of prices, allowing, and mobilization do not scale down neatly.

The government Financial investment Tax obligation Credit scores presently sits at 30 percent for certifying systems, consisting of batteries when charged by solar. It is a credit report, not a discount check, so it lowers tax obligation obligation rather than including money to your checking account. For house owners without sufficient tax appetite in a single year, there is the potential to lug unused credit report forward. California's Self‑Generation Reward Program has provided battery refunds, though funding tiers and qualification shift. Serious installers stay up to date with those details and can tell you if bucks stay in your energy region at the time you buy.

Leases and power acquisition arrangements from solar providers streamline in advance costs but make complex resale and usually deliver reduced life time financial savings than fundings or cash money acquisitions. They have their location. If you lack tax obligation obligation to utilize the federal credit score or you want a pure expense countered without maintenance responsibility, a PPA can fit. Or else, a straightforward loan without any junk costs, a realistic payment schedule, and the alternative to pre-pay primary tends to age better.

One much more regional subtlety: time‑of‑use rates in PG&E region drive a lot of worth into late‑afternoon and evening. If you work with a team that merely sizes a system to counter annual kilowatt‑hours without considering when you use them, you will leave cost savings on the table. Request for modeling under your certain rate strategy and a minimum of 2 lots forms, weekdays and weekends.

Permits, affiliation, and sensible timelines

Permitting in Stockton normally goes through the city's Building Division for rooftops, with plan review that can take anywhere from a couple of service days to a number of weeks depending on work. San Joaquin Region handles unincorporated areas. Many property tasks receive expedited solar licenses if the style meets architectural and electric list criteria. HOA authorizations, if applicable, rest on a different timeline. California law avoids HOAs from unreasonably restricting solar, but they can need notice and aesthetic standards.

After setup, the utility interconnection application moves you toward Permission to Run. In PG&E area, PTO typically takes 1 to 3 weeks once inspections pass, though some projects clear in a few days and others rest longer if documents jumps. Include it up and a clean project from signed agreement to PTO may take 6 to 10 weeks. Roofing system replacements, primary panel upgrades, and custom-made carports stretch the calendar.

How to compare quotes without obtaining lost in jargon

The most basic means to keep deals directly is to level the playing area. Cost per watt is a beneficial starting statistics, yet it can deceive if one layout consists of a primary panel upgrade, thicker crowning achievement to reduce voltage surge, or a much longer handiwork service warranty. A reasonable method looks at:

First, total price after incentives and what the payment timetable appears like, including deposits and last repayment causes. Second, tools choices and what problem each selection resolves for your home. For example, why microinverters rather than a single inverter, and how that affects shade tolerance. Third, estimated yearly manufacturing and the loss assumptions behind it. Trained groups divulge dirtying, wiring, mismatch, and temperature losses instead of burying them. 4th, interconnection information with PG&E, and anticipated export prices under the Internet Payment policies particular to your rate plan. Fifth, maintenance and surveillance arrangements. Can you see panel‑level information? Who receives automated informs if a microinverter goes offline? Exists a solution vehicle that covers Stockton routinely or is aid sent off from the Bay Location when timetables open up?

Be skeptical of residential solar panel install quotes that lug too many contingencies. A line product that reviews "rate conditional after site survey" is fair if made use of to confirm roof structure or service gear, but not if it comes to be a catch‑all to bump the job by thousands. If a contractor anticipates a main panel upgrade, they need to claim so up front and show why, for instance inadequate busbar score for a 125 percent guideline backfeed or no complimentary breaker rooms with safe clearances.

Roof realities: age, material, and condition

Solar panels last licensed solar installation companies near me 25 years or more, often with an efficiency guarantee that ends at 80 to 90 percent of the initial output. A worn‑out roofing becomes a costly detour. If your composition roof shingles remain in the last 3rd of their life, take into consideration a reroof or at least a reroof of the range areas prior to setting up solar. Stockton summer seasons bake shingles. The surface may look passable from the road, however granule loss and curling at the tabs inform the genuine tale. Changing roof shingles under a variety two or three years after installation means paying to remove and reinstall the system together with the roofing system work. If you are considering proposals and one solar business advises patching while one more pushes for a reroof, request for photos, material specifications, and life-span price quotes. The individual technique usually costs less over 20 years.

Tile adds its very own spin. Concrete floor tiles can be raised and refit with substitute flashing, however fragile clay ceramic tiles from older homes split easily. An installer experienced with tile should possess that risk and bring spare tiles, or propose a comp‑out under the range, changing ceramic tile with composite shingle in that footprint and blinking to the surrounding floor tile programs. That service looks strange from above yet is undetectable from the visual, and it speeds service phone calls later since crews are not tiptoeing on clay.

Flat areas on additions are less common but not unusual. Ballasted racking avoids penetrations on some commercial tasks, yet many residential level roofing systems still require secured installs because of wind and uplift rules. TPO and foam need certain blinking packages to maintain the manufacturer's warranty. If your quote plays down the roof covering membrane layer brand or solar installation Stockton age, ask follow‑ups.

Batteries, blackouts, and time‑of‑use strategy

Under Internet Billing, batteries typically relocate from optional to beneficial. The math is not global, but if your family runs hefty from 4 to 9 p.m., a right‑sized battery can cover an excellent portion of that home window. Modeling ought to show round‑trip performance losses, generally 8 to 15 percent, and any inverter clipping if your solar variety is much larger than inverter capacity. Few people get this level of information unless they ask. Ask.

If you want backup power, supply your important tons. A well pump or a 3‑ton central air conditioner device may amaze you with start‑up existing. Some batteries can deal with motor inrush with soft start kits, while others need lots losing or a protected lots panel. Stockton's summer nights are hot, however not every back-up system can bring whole‑home a/c. A ductless mini‑split in a living location or a ceiling fan paired with careful home window administration could be the useful course for blackout comfort.

For rewards, examine the present condition of SGIP financing. Programs open and close, and various equity rates lug various guidelines. Serious installers will know where your address lands and what paperwork you need.

Ground places, carports, and small-acreage options

Many San Joaquin Area homes rest on larger whole lots with sufficient space for a ground range or a little carport. Ground mounts expense more per watt than easy roofs due to trenching, blog posts, and fence, yet they can tilt to the sunlight precisely and avoid roof infiltrations. A backyard 8 kW ground range needs space, a clear south or southwest exposure, and occasionally a minor grading plan. Plan for channel runs and a trench path that prevents watering lines. Carports add steel, grounds, and architectural calcs, yet they resolve color and auto parking at once.

Production approximates you can trust

Any quote worth signing must disclose the software application utilized and the loss pile. PVWatts is the Division of Power's free criterion and suffices for ball park numbers. HelioScope and comparable devices include color modeling and electric details. Destruction needs to fall in between 0.3 and 0.8 percent each year for contemporary modules. Dust in the Central Valley is genuine. A sensible dirtying loss might be 2 to 5 percent every year depending on your immediate surroundings and whether you rinse panels during the driest months. Efficiency ratio, essentially just how much of the incident sunlight comes to be alternating current after all losses, ought to be discussed instead of waved away.

Look at the first‑year manufacturing number and the 25‑year cumulative. Strong propositions show monthly break downs, not just a solitary yearly number. They must additionally validate that the selection meets fire code setbacks. Absolutely nothing ends a strategy check faster than panels crowding eaves or hips.

Service after the selfie

Solar is a lengthy video game. The van that appears in year seven matters. Stockton has both shop installers and bigger regional solar companies. The little staffs commonly win on workmanship and interaction. The bigger ones may have much deeper service benches and faster guarantee processing. Either design can work if you confirm that there is a service division with ticketing, specified feedback times, and equipping of usual components like microinverters and fast closure tools. Ask to see the surveillance system live, not just screenshots. If the system tosses a sharp, that obtains it? You only, the installer only, or both?

Workmanship warranties differ commonly. 10 years on roof penetrations is a reasonable bar. A five‑year pledge is light. Twenty is generous, yet ask the amount of years the business has actually existed and what happens to your insurance coverage if they offer business. Tools guarantees rest with manufacturers. Panels commonly lug 12 to 25 years on product defects and 25 years on performance. Inverters and batteries vary from 10 to 25 years with throughput limits on storage. See to it your agreement lists serial‑tracked service warranties and who submits claims.

The door‑knock problem and how to handle it

Stockton neighborhoods see their share of solar door‑to‑door sales. Some associates are knowledgeable. Some promise too much. California provides you a right to terminate particular in‑home sales within a short home window. If a rep urges you to sign tonight to catch a vanishing refund, slow down. Great solar firms Stockton home owners trust honor a gauged process. Take a day, reviewed the contract, phone call recommendations, and request a sample utility expense evaluation that shows how your prices shift by season.

Watch out for intro rates on financing that balloon after a short introductory duration, or dealer charges that are stuffed into the task rate. A car loan with a 2.99 percent promotional price often hides a 15 to 25 percent supplier cost that pumps up expense and tightens your tools choices.

When a second opinion pays off

A second opinion is not an insult, it is due diligence. If one installer states your major panel can accept a backfeed breaker and one more demands a complete upgrade, inquire both to show their mathematics. The 120 percent rule, busbar score, and breaker positioning are not subjective. Similarly, if bids differ widely on system dimension, examine the tons presumptions. Some proposals quietly add an EV and a heatpump water heater to warrant more kilowatts. Including future loads can be smart, but just if it matches your plans.

For homes with complicated shielding from tall trees on the delta wind side, insist on site color dimensions with a device like a Solar Pathfinder or SunEye. Satellite images miss out on seasonal leaf decrease and neighbor remodels. One shaded panel on a poorly developed string can drag outcome throughout the whole row without optimizers.

A few final, useful notes

Keep records. Save your style set, permit, assessment record, affiliation letter, identification numbers, and guarantee PDFs in one folder. Your future self will thanks throughout a refinance, a home sale, or a warranty case. Label your important tons if you have a battery, and examination back-up yearly. Clean panels only when required, usually after the most awful of the completely dry period dirt, and do it safely or hire it out. Think about a yearly check-up where a professional confirms torque on roof covering hardware, examines circuitry, and updates firmware on inverters or batteries.
